EDITORS COMMENTS
This evocative black and white portrait captures the enigmatic presence of Mary Roberts, taken by renowned photographer Arnold Genthe in 1915. Mary is depicted indoors, seated in a chair with a pensive expression, her hands clasped in her lap. She wears an elegant fur coat draped over her shoulders, a high-necked blouse, and a voluminous skirt, all typical of the fashionable women's wear of the era. A bouquet of flowers sits on the table beside her, adding a touch of nature to the otherwise grim interior. Mary's hairstyle, with its intricate braids and flowers intertwined, was a popular choice for women during this time. Her direct gaze and posture exude a sense of confidence and composure, making for a captivating and timeless image. This glass negative photograph, part of the vast collection at the Library of Congress, offers a glimpse into the past, showcasing both the fashion and the emotional depth of the early 20th century.
